Long story, I hgave an X on a Obsession Vortex 21. I have tried props from 26-32 on it. Thought i would be smart and put a 26 PP drag 4 for the smaller lakes and wined it up to the govener for high 90,s at 7100, nope only spins it to 66-6700 and hits a wall. Swaped for a 28 drag 4 same rpm more mph 97 plus mph. 32 drag 4 105 mph at around 6300 with a long river to run and i mean long run. Favorite prop a tweaked 15x30 Hoss HPD runs just oner 100 at around 6300 but will haul my self and my wife their.
My exerience shoot for the biggest wheel you can spin to 62-6300 rpm. I thought it would spin that 26 to the govener quick but it just cant move enough air upstairs. It seams like it kas COPD or something. I call it my Cummins it makes the power not the rpms. I wish it ran like my drag.

Yes was trying to spin the 26 to the 7100 rpm governor but it just wouldn't do it. In my own uneducated opinion it isn't a good air pump above 6300 rpm. It just hits a wall. So i give it what it wants and try to take advantage of the torque. That 32 is kind of a slug unless i am light and by myself,not a good all around prop for my set up.
